Some background:
The P-51 was a relative latecomer to the Pacific Theatre. This was due largely to the need for the aircraft in Europe, although the P-38's twin-engine design was considered a safety advantage for long over-water flights. The first P-51s were deployed in the Far East later in 1944, operating in close-support and escort missions, as well as tactical photo reconnaissance. As the war in Europe wound down, the P-51 became more common: eventually, with the capture of Iwo Jima, it was able to be used as a bomber escort during B-29 missions against the Japanese homeland.

Anyway, impressed by the type's performance, the U. S. Navy requested a navalized version of the able fighter – despite the preference for radial engines. Work on the so-called Sea Mustang began in early 1944 with the intention to provide the U.S. Navy with a long range, high performance successor for the Grumman F6F Hellcat. The specifications called for an aircraft able to operate from the smallest carrier, primarily in the interceptor role.

North American's F1J idea to modify the proven Mustang to marine needs took a long way – longer and more twisted than expected. A first attempt to navalize the Mustang was done under the "Project Seahorse": An early-series P-51D-5-NA, serial number 44-14017, was re-designated ETF-51D and sent to Mustin Field, near Philadelphia, for initial carrier utility testing in September 1944. One of the runways at Mustin Field was specially modified in order to test the naval Mustang. Markings simulating the size of an aircraft carrier's deck were realized and arrester cables were installed, as well as a launch catapult.

During the months of September and October 1944, test pilot Lt. Bob Elder made nearly 150 simulated launches and landings with the ETF-51D. Sufficient data concerning the Mustang's low speed handling had to be gathered before carrier trials could begin.
The Mustang's laminar-flow wing made for little drag and high speed but was relatively inefficient at low speed, resulting in a high stall speed. As the arrester cables could not be engaged at more than 90 mph, Elder reported that "from the start, it was obvious to everyone that the margin between the stall speed of the aircraft (82 mph) and the speed imposed by the arrester gear (90 mph) was very limited."

Rudder control at low speeds and high angles of attack was inadequate. In addition, landing attitude had to be carefully controlled to avoid damaging the airframe upon landing. One of the handling quirks of the Mustang was also potentially dangerous: during a missed approach or a wave-off, power had to be re-applied gently, due to torque. If not, the aircraft could roll rapidly, or even snap-roll. At such low speed and altitude, the result could only be fatal.


1:72 North American F1J "Sea Mustang"; VF-82, USS Bennington (CV-20), April 1945 (Whif/Heller kit conversion) by dizzyfugu, on Flickr

Later, the tests went on with live action on board of a carrier, the USS Shangri-La (CV-38). Bob Elder "made all carrier landings at the speed of 85 mph. Luckily, the Mustang reacted well, even in the most delicate situations. One just had to use the throttle wisely." Elder reported that speed control on the ETF-51D was excellent. He also stated that "the forward visibility was good and never gave me any problems. In fact, fighters with radial engines such as the F4U or F6F were worse than the P-51 in that respect." The aircraft also behaved well during catapult launches.

The carrier suitability trials were rather short, though: only 25 landings and launches were made. Elder wrote "Although I had 'premiered' many US Navy aircraft carrier landings, no such experience had been as interesting as with the Mustang".
However, North American Aviation did not forget about the ETF-51D experiments. Building on this experience, the company later presented another navalized Mustang project to the Navy: NAA-133. This machine was technically based on the P-51H, the last Mustang model to see production. The airframe of the NAA-133 was strengthened, though, as the P-51H airframe was lighter but not as sturdy as the P-51D's.

The kit and its assembly
The idea of a navalized Mustang is IMHO a nice and rich whif theme. When I delved into history I was surprised that the idea as such had actually been taken to hardware status – the ETF-51D mentioned above is/was real, as well as the later NAA-133 proposal to the USN. But the latter never got as far as described, and that's where whifery came to play. Anyway, what sounds like a simple plan became a major surgery, since I wanted more than just a blue P-51 with a hook glued to it.

My original plan was to convert a Hobby Boss kit, but when I tried to move both cockpit and radiator bath forward, that kit's massive (!) fuselage piece prevented any decent modification. Hence, I fell back to an "old school" P-51D kit with two fuselage halves: a Heller Mustang which I still had in my stack. Not a bad kit, but with its raised panel lines it certainly is sub-optimal, esp. when you change many things on the hull.

Both cockpit and radiator intake were moved about 5mm forward, a major surgery. The cockpit was taken OOB, just some ribs inside and a pilot figure were added (an old Matchbox figure), and radio equipment simulated behind the seat. The canopy was cut open.


1:72 North American F1J "Sea Mustang"; VF-82, USS Bennington (CV-20), April 1945 (Whif/Heller kit conversion) - WIP by dizzyfugu, on Flickr

The contraprop is new, too, a scratch-built piece, made from, AFAIK an F4U drop tank. It gives the Sea Mustang a sleek, beefy look, but also makes sense from an operational point of view.

The landing gear received new/better wheels and extra struts, also for a sturdier look. The new tail wheel was taken from an Airfix A-1 Skyraider, with an added arrester hook and an accordingly modified well with new/longer covers.

The tail was completely modified: the horizontal stabilizers were replaced by bigger ones, taken from an F4U, and the original vertical rudder was replaced by a taller construction created from a Ju-87G rudder (!) and a stabilizer from a Bell AH-1, both ancient Matchbox kits.
The Heller kit provides a separate fin fillet piece, but I left it away, in order to pronounce the taller fin and longer back of the F1J.


1:72 North American F1J "Sea Mustang"; VF-82, USS Bennington (CV-20), April 1945 (Whif/Heller kit conversion) - WIP by dizzyfugu, on Flickr

The wings received wing tip tanks (taken from a Grumman F9F Panther) as well as a changed armament with four cannons with longer barrels (from the Airfix A-1) instead of the classic six 0.5" machine guns. New panel lines, where the wing folding joints would be, were engraved. In order to add some realism for display, flaps were opened/lowered - an easy task with the Heller kit.

The 250 lbs. bombs were taken straight from the Heller kit, the 5" HVARs come from a Matchbox Grumman F9F Panther, with scratch-built launch rails made from polystyrene profiles (Evergreen).


Painting & Markings
The old adage that a subtle whif works best with a simple livery is true: the dark blue (FS15042/AN607) suits the slender lines of the Mustang very well, even if it is my hunchback modification! Unfortunately, my favourite paint choice, Humbrol 181, is out of production (Shame on you, Airfix!), so I had to hunt down Testors' 1718 as a replacement.
All interior surfaces were painted with Humbrol 226 (Interior Green), then dry-brushed with Zinc Chromate (Testors 1734) and Humbrol 80 (Grass Green).


1:72 North American F1J "Sea Mustang"; VF-82, USS Bennington (CV-20), April 1945 (Whif/Heller kit conversion) by dizzyfugu, on Flickr

Markings were taken from 1:72 a Hobby Boss F4U (leftover from my FAS conversion) and a vintage F6F from Monogram in 1:48. The squadron markings depict a machine from VF-82 "Fighting Fools", based on the carrier USS Bennington (CV-20) in the Pacific theatre in 1945. National insignia had to be puzzled together and improvised with white stars and separate all-white bars. The yellow band behind the propeller rather belongs to machines from VF-84 on board of USS Bunker Hill (CV-17), though, but since this is a whif, the marking is a nice contrast to the all-blue livery. That the machine sports the bort number "82" is a weird conincidence!

Some weathering was done with dry-brushing (e. g. Humbrol 77 & 189), rubbed graphite dust and soot stains around cannons and exhausts, and light colour chipping on leading edges and around the cockpit was done. Finally, the kit received a coat with semi-gloss varnish – I did not dare using a 100% gloss coat, because that would IMHO have made the machine look too new and out of scale.
